Key Considerations Before Buying
- Verify that the protector is specifically cut for the Osmo Pocket 3 or 4—the CYNOVA model claims compatibility with both, but you should check for precise alignment with the camera's curved lens housing and the LCD screen's edges to avoid bubbles or peeling.
- Evaluate the optical clarity: an ultra-HD tempered glass film should not introduce glare or reduce touch sensitivity. Look for an oleophobic coating to resist fingerprints, which is critical for a touchscreen-driven device like the Osmo Pocket.
- Consider the installation ease: a wet or dry application method can affect adhesion. Protectors with an alignment frame (common in CYNOVA kits) reduce the risk of misalignment, especially on the small, recessed screen of the Pocket 3/4.

Common Issues
A frequent problem is protectors that interfere with the camera's gimbal or lens movement—poorly cut films can catch on the rotating lens cap or cause touchscreen lag. Another issue is adhesive failure in humid or hot environments, leading to bubbling or peeling within weeks.
Quality Indicators
High-quality protectors use AGC or Corning glass, feature a smooth oleophobic coating, and include a precise cutout for the lens and microphone. Verified user photos showing the protector in use on an actual Osmo Pocket 3/4 are a strong signal of fit and durability.
